What Are Digital Job Sheets and How Do They Benefit Tradespeople?

 

Digital job sheets are electronic versions of traditional paper work orders, designed to facilitate task management and documentation for tradespeople. They enhance workflow efficiency by allowing for real-time updates and easy access to job information from mobile devices. 

This transition to paperless systems not only reduces the risk of paperwork errors but also can help speed up job completion, supporting improved customer satisfaction and potentially increased revenue.

Integrating digital job sheets into daily operations can yield significant cost savings. By eliminating the need for physical paperwork, tradespeople can reduce material costs associated with printing and storage. 

Furthermore, the efficiency gained through streamlined processes can create capacity for more work, as jobs are completed faster and with fewer errors.

How Digital Job Sheets Improve Workflow Efficiency and Accuracy

 

Digital Job Sheets Improve Workflow Efficiency and Accuracy

Digital job sheets improve workflow efficiency by automating routine tasks and providing instant access to job details. This automation minimizes the time spent on administrative duties, allowing tradespeople to focus on their core work. 

For instance, with mobile access to job sheets, technicians can update job statuses, often capture customer signatures, and document work completed on-site, all in real-time. This immediate feedback loop enhances communication between team members and clients, ensuring everyone is informed and aligned.

Moreover, the accuracy of digital job sheets significantly reduces the likelihood of errors that often occur with manual data entry. By utilizing templates and standardized forms, tradespeople can ensure that all necessary information is captured consistently, leading to fewer disputes and misunderstandings with clients.

How Customizable Job Cards and Offline Mode Improve Job Tracking

 

Customizable electronic job cards allow tradespeople to tailor job sheets to their specific needs, ensuring that all relevant information is captured. This customization can include fields for client details, job specifications, and materials used, making it easier to track job progress and outcomes.

Additionally, offline capabilities are crucial for tradespeople working in areas with limited internet connectivity. By allowing technicians to access and update job sheets without a constant internet connection, businesses can ensure that work continues uninterrupted, even in challenging environments.

Industry-Specific Features for Compliance and Documentation

 

Digital job sheets often include industry-specific features that support compliance and documentation requirements. For example, HVAC technicians may need to document compliance with safety regulations, while electricians must adhere to local codes and standards. 

Digital job sheets can include checklists and compliance forms that ensure all necessary documentation is completed accurately and efficiently. 

Additionally, the ability to store and retrieve historical job data easily can be invaluable for audits and inspections, providing a clear record of work performed and compliance with industry standards.

How Integration Streamlines Scheduling, Invoicing, and Reporting

 

Integration of digital job sheets with scheduling and invoicing systems streamlines these processes by automating data entry and reducing the risk of errors. 

For example, when a job is completed, the system can automatically generate an invoice based on the work documented in the digital job sheet. This automation not only saves time but also ensures accuracy in billing and reporting.

Furthermore, integrated reporting tools can provide insights into job performance, client satisfaction, and overall business efficiency, enabling tradespeople to make informed decisions and drive growth.

What Security Measures Should Be Considered When Using Digital Job Sheets?

 

When using digital job sheets, it is crucial to implement robust security measures to protect sensitive client and business information. This includes using secure cloud storage solutions with encryption, ensuring that access is restricted to authorized personnel, and regularly updating software to patch vulnerabilities. 

Additionally, training team members on best practices for data security, such as recognizing phishing attempts and using strong passwords, can further safeguard against potential breaches.
